Description

Design, build and deploy full-stack features using Next.js, TypeScript, Go and PostgreSQL.Develop APIs, backend services and cloud functions across modern cloud infrastructure.Collaborate with the Engineering Lead to execute the technical roadmap.Break down complex initiatives into manageable, deployable increments.Maintain high coding standards through testing, code reviews and documentation.Support and mentor engineers by helping solve complex technical challenges.Take ownership of systems from development through to production support. A successful Software Engineer should have: 3+ years' professional software engineering experience.Strong expertise in TypeScript, Next.js, PostgreSQL and Go.Experience with Prisma or similar ORM technologies.Exposure to AWS, Supabase, Vercel and infrastructure-as-code tools.Strong understanding of CI/CD pipelines, GitHub Actions and software delivery practices.Excellent communication skills with a collaborative approach to problem solving.Ability to balance quality, delivery speed and long-term maintainability. Our client is an innovative SaaS company focused on delivering technology solutions that help improve outcomes for students. Competitive salary range of $120,000 to $140,000 AUD.Permanent position in Melbourne within the Saas sector.Opportunity to contribute to meaningful projects that make a difference.
